Classes are designed for the serious experienced student. Auditions are required for placement. Classes are held from 2 to 6 days per week based on age and ability, and are designed to challenge the students technically as well as provide a disciplined environment. Dress code is mandatory and regular attendance required. (2 consecutive absences result in probationary membership.) All missed classes must be made up.  Students are highly encouraged to attend classes in all dance disciplines.

Modern

A concert style of dance that originally began in an effort to break the traditional codified rules of ballet. Varying elements include breath, contraction and release, grounded movement, floor work and fall and recovery. Dancers should wear any solid color leotard, shorts, leggings or tights and be barefoot with their hair pulled back out of the face.
